Job Summary and Qualifications

As the Maintenance Mechanic, you will perform work on building systems throughout the hospital. As a member of the Facilities Management team, you will have important contact with patients, visitors and clinical staff every day. You will utilize your mechanical aptitude and knowledge of facility and plant operations to provide a safe environment for patients and staff.

  • You will perform routine maintenance and light repairs in areas including plumbing, medical gas, doors and hardware, electrical, nurse call and HVAC systems
  • You will operate building automation systems
  • You will ensure the operation of fixed plant equipment by performing daily building and equipment checks and recording status of equipment
  • You will respond to building system casualties and fire alarms and take immediate action to restore services
  • You will install and/or change out appliances and wall hangings
  • You are responsible for scheduled preventative maintenance on building systems
  • You will assist in controlling and maintaining the materials inventory

    St. David’s Georgetown Hospital is a comprehensive healthcare facility located north of Austin, Texas. This medical center features more than 100 patient beds and is known for its Level IV trauma center, Certified Primary Stroke Center, and Certified Chest Pain Center. The hospital’s range of services include 24-hour emergency care, inpatient and outpatient surgery, maternity and newborn care, rehabilitation, and more.

    St. David’s Georgetown Hospital is part of St. David’s HealthCare, which is one of the largest healthcare systems in Texas and the third-largest employer in the Austin area. St. David’s HealthCare was formed through a unique partnership between HCA Healthcare and two local nonprofits — St. David’s Foundation and Georgetown Health Foundation.
